I have a lot of friends in Cameron who shrimp. Before the strike, the only shrimp house in Cameron was giving them 60 cents for 10/15's.
My dad and I installed a few IQF systems in their boats and at their houses and they paid us in shrimp because they have so much and they are not making any money. I got 100 lbs. of fresh headed shrimp last time I was home for 1 days work. They are selling the jumbo shrimp off the boats for around $2.50 to $3.50 per pound. When I was off work, they had 31/35's, 21/25's, 16/20's with some 10/15's mixed in. My wife liked shrimp until she married me. I get 400 to 500 lbs. a year for refrigeration work. |
